Jogging routes around Labergement-Lès-Seurre are characterized by flat terrain and proximity to waterways. The region features a network of paths along canals and through rural landscapes, offering minimal elevation changes. This makes the area suitable for runners seeking gentle, accessible routes.

Due to the large locks in Ecuelles and Seurre, some old locks have been eliminated. There are still monuments without function and without lock gates

The bleachers are laid out facing the Saône. All you have to do is settle down there to rest for a few moments and enjoy the view of Seurre on the small marina. If you're hot, cool off at the refreshment bar set up on the quays. You can also fill your water bottles at the fountain located just across the road.

There are over 70 running routes in the Labergement-Lès-Seurre area, offering a variety of distances and experiences. Most of these are considered moderate, with a good selection of easy paths as well.
The running trails around Labergement-Lès-Seurre are characterized by their flat terrain and close proximity to waterways, particularly canals. You'll find a network of paths winding through rural landscapes, offering minimal elevation changes ideal for a smooth run.
Yes, Labergement-Lès-Seurre offers several easy running paths perfect for beginners. For instance, the Running loop from Seurre is a 3.1-mile (5.0 km) trail leading through flat, open countryside, often completed in about 31 minutes.
Many of the flat, canal-side paths around Labergement-Lès-Seurre are suitable for families. Their minimal elevation makes them accessible for various fitness levels. The Running loop from Seurre is a great option for a shorter, easy family run.
Yes, many of the routes in the region are circular,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. A good example is the Seurre Lock — Canal Bypass loop from Seurre, which offers a 9.8 km (6.1 miles) loop along the canal.
For a longer run, consider the Château de Seurre - B&B – Chateau / KH loop from Seurre, which is a moderate 7.0 miles (11.3 km) path exploring the rural surroundings and offering views of the local chateau.

While specific parking details vary by route, many trails in the Labergement-Lès-Seurre area, especially those starting from villages like Seurre, offer convenient parking options. It's advisable to check the starting point of your chosen route for the best parking access.
The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 3.3 stars. Runners often praise the flat, accessible terrain and the peaceful canal-side paths, which provide a relaxing and enjoyable running experience away from steep climbs.
Many of the rural and canal-side paths are generally suitable for running with dogs, provided they are kept on a leash and you adhere to local regulations regarding pets in public areas. The open nature of many routes offers space for you and your canine companion.
The flat terrain makes running enjoyable thro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er can be warm, so early morning or late evening runs are often preferred. Winter running is also possible, as the routes typically remain accessible.
